One of the proposed solutions to the scalability challenge is the implementation of the Lightning Network. This innovative technology aims to reduce the burden on the main Bitcoin blockchain by enabling off-chain transactions. By creating a network of payment channels that operate independently of the main blockchain, the Lightning Network has the potential to significantly increase the speed and efficiency of Bitcoin transactions.

Another hot topic at the conference was the concept of sidechains. Sidechains are separate blockchains that are connected to the main Bitcoin network, allowing for the development of new features and functionalities without compromising the security and integrity of the original blockchain. By utilizing sidechains, developers can explore new ideas and innovations while keeping the core Bitcoin network stable and secure.
